Jewish Encyclopedia

The "Jewish Encyclopedia" is a 12-volume reference work containing information on the history, religion, and culture of the Jewish people. It was published in English by Funk & Wagnalls between 1901 and 1906. The encyclopedia contains over 15,000 articles and historical illustrations. Its historical scope and scholarship remain valuable to researchers, and it is currently in the public domain.

Catholic Encyclopedia

The Catholic Encyclopedia is an English-language reference work published in the United States. Designed to provide authoritative information on Catholic history, doctrine, and culture, the original edition was published between 1907 and 1912 by the Robert Appleton Company.
